What is the greatest common factor of 630 and 910?

The GCF of 630 and 910 is 70

The prime factorization of 630 is 2*5*7*3*3
The prime factorization of 910 is 2*5*7*13

The common prime factors are 2*5*7 so the GCF is 70.
